Coverage Options for Pet Insurance in NH

There are several coverage options available for pet insurance in NH. The most common types of coverage include accident-only, illness-only, and comprehensive coverage. Accident-only coverage covers only injuries caused by accidents, such as broken bones or lacerations. Illness-only coverage covers only illnesses, such as cancer or diabetes. Comprehensive coverage covers both accidents and illnesses, as well as routine care such as vaccinations and annual check-ups.

Exceptions and Exclusions to Pet Insurance Policies

It's important to note that there are exceptions and exclusions to pet insurance policies. Pre-existing conditions, elective procedures, and cosmetic procedures may not be covered. Additionally, some policies may have breed-specific exclusions or age limits. It's important to read the policy carefully and ask questions before signing up for pet insurance.

Factors That Can Affect the Cost of Pet Insurance

Several factors can affect the cost of pet insurance in NH. These factors include the age and breed of your pet, the level of coverage you choose, and your location. Older pets and certain breeds may be more expensive to insure due to their increased risk of health issues. Comprehensive coverage will typically be more expensive than accident-only or illness-only coverage. Additionally, living in an area with higher veterinary costs may increase the cost of pet insurance.

Understanding the Claim Process for Pet Insurance

The claim process for pet insurance is similar to that of human health insurance. First, you will need to pay the vet bill upfront. Then, you will submit a claim to the insurance company for reimbursement. Some policies may require pre-authorization for certain procedures or treatments. Be sure to read the policy carefully and understand the claim process before signing up for pet insurance.

2. What does pet insurance cover?

The coverage of pet insurance can vary depending on the policy and provider. Generally, pet insurance can cover accidents, illnesses, and sometimes routine care such as vaccinations and check-ups.

3. How much does pet insurance cost in NH?

The cost of pet insurance in NH can depend on factors such as your pet's breed, age, and health history, as well as the type of coverage you choose. On average, pet insurance in NH can range from $20 to $60 per month.
